RIDAO (Rapid Intrinsic Disorder Analysis Online): Integrated high-throughput protein disorder prediction
RIDAO predicts intrinsically disordered proteins (IDPs) and disordered regions at per-residue resolution by integrating six established disorder prediction algorithms. It reproduces individual predictor outputs while enabling genome-scale intrinsic disorder analysis.
Key Features:
- Multi-Predictor Integration: Combines six established intrinsic disorder predictors into a unified computational framework with high fidelity to original methods.
- High-Throughput Performance: Generates per-residue disorder predictions two to six orders of magnitude faster than AUCpreD, IUPred3, metapredict V2, flDPnn, and SPOT-Disorder2.
- Large-Scale Scalability: Processes datasets exceeding one million protein sequences (>420 million residues) from 100 organisms in under one hour.
Scientific Applications:
- Genome-Scale Structural Bioinformatics: Enables comparative genomics and proteomics analyses of intrinsic disorder across diverse organisms and large proteome datasets.
Methodology:
RIDAO executes and consolidates predictions from six established intrinsic disorder algorithms within a unified pipeline, producing per-residue disorder scores suitable for large-scale structural and comparative analyses.
